Marriage Certificate of James Baxter and Emma Hodgson
26 December 1881


1881 Marriage solemnized at the Parish Church, in the Parish of Bradford, in the County of York.

Number 192
When Married Twentysixth December 1881
Name and Surname James Baxter Emma Hodgson
Age 21 years 21 years
Condition Bachelor Spinster
Rank or Profession Weaving Overlooker Weaver
Residence at the time of Marriage 5 Undercliffe Street, Bradford 5 Undercliffe Street, Bradford
Father's Name and Surname James Baxter (deceased) Halliday Hodgson
Rank or Profession of Father Cloth Weaver Weaver

Married in the Parish Church according to the Rites and Ceremonies of the Established Church after Banns by me, R.S.H. Robertson BA

This Marriage was solemnized between us James Baxter
Emma Hodgson
in the Presence of us Joseph Halliday
Hannah Bradley


Source: West Yorkshire Archive Service; Yorkshire Parish Records BDP14
Source: Ancestry.com. West Yorkshire, England, Marriages and Banns, 1813-1935

GRO Ref: D1881 - Bradford 9b 196
